The order impugned is passed under Order XLI Rule 27 of the CPC, whereby the prayer of the petitioner moved vide Exh.24 for permission to produce additional evidence at appellate stage in the form of power of attorney came to be rejected.

3.

The appeal in which the said proceedings were taken out by the petitioner is already decided against him which is subject matter of the challenge in Revision Application Stamp No.25913 of 2021 viz. Revision Application No.144 of 2022. 4.

In view of above, the writ petition stands disposed of as petitioner is at liberty to raise the issue as regards validity of the order questioned in the aforesaid petition during hearing of the Revision Application.
